Published by Lantern
Books, "Beauty Without the Beasts:
A Guide to Cruelty-Free Personal Care",
provides information and tools to help consumers choose animal-friendly
personal care products, apparel, food, entertainment, and more.
Beautifully illustrated and written, it offers specific product
guidelines and background information on what products contain animal
ingredients and how readers can identify them.

Highlights of Beauty
without the Beasts include: · A listing of over 600 makers of household
and personal care products that do not test on animals · Identification
of animal materials commonly used in apparel, including fur, leather,
ivory, silk, etc. · Benefits of a plant-based diet, listing specific
product suggestions for meat and dairy alternatives · Practical
approaches to humane living, including health charities that do
not fund animal experiments · Exploration of humanity’s spiritual
relationship with animals, with related stories from various faiths
· Helpful books, companies, and charities offering more details
on topics introduced in the book.

WE
FEED THE WORLD - The real price of food.
The book accompanying Erwin Wagenhofer's acclaimed
documentary. With a foreword by Germany's former minister of consumer
interests Renate Künast and 36 coloured stills.
"Never before have we lived so well, never before have we been
so healthy, never before have we lived so long. We have everything
we want." Peter Brabeck, CEO Nestlé International.
The Brazilian rainforest is destroyed to make way for soy plantations
that produce animal feed for Europe. Agricultural products, subsidized
by the EU and exported to Africa, undercut prices on local markets.
Everyday the bodies of numerous Africans are retrieved from the
Mediterranean as people are risking their lives trying to escape
the ever-increasing poverty of their native countries ... Erwin
Wagenhofer has traced back our food and visited the people involved
in their workplaces and homes; from the greenhouses of Andalucia
to Breton fishing cutters and the offices of Nestlé's executive
board.
We Feed The World provides an insight into the extensive research
preceding the making of the movie of the same title. It unveils
the background of the global food industry that pretends to act
in the consumers' interest and explains the production process of
milk, vegetables, bread, fish, meat and water. It shows us the harm
done by our consumption, which is often hidden behind the luxuriance
of consumer goods and their advertising.
Alongside environmental concerns, human protagonists are at the
centre of the book ... as producers, consumers and as victims.
Vegetarian
or not, this book (and the film) provides an essential insight
surrounding the gross mismanagement of our earth.
At present, We Feed the World is only available in German.
